2.9 KiB
title | taxonomy | visible | |||
---|---|---|---|---|---|
Создание правил для DNS фильтрации |
|
true |
AdGuard для Android и AdGuard Home предоставляют функцию фильтрации DNS трафика. Чтобы узнать больше о DNS-фильтрации, перейдите в эту статью Базы знаний. В сравнении с традиционной блокировкой рекламы, DNS-фильтрация является более "грубым" методом и не даёт таких широких возможностей настройки. Она не поддерживает сложный синтаксис, используемый нами в обычных фильтрах, но зато поддерживает упрощённый синтаксис, позволяющий блокировать конкретные домены.
DNS фильтрация поддерживает два типа правил:
-
Основные правила фильтрации, такие как Базовые правила, но с поддержкой ограниченного набора модификаторов:
$important
$match-case
- Правила с другими модификаторами будут проигнорированы
-
Правила «Hosts», такие же, как
/etc/hosts
Примеры:
||example.org^
- блокирует доступ к example.org и ко всем его поддоменам@@||example.org^
- разблокирует доступ к example.org и ко всем его поддоменам0.0.0.0 example.org
- AdGuard будет возвращать 0.0.0.0 адрес для example.org (но не к его поддоменам)! Это комментарий
- комментирование# И это комментарий
- тоже комментирование/REGEX/
- блокирует доступ к доменам, соответствующим заданному регулярному выражению
Используйте этот синтаксис, чтобы создавать или импортировать правила в DNS-фильтр. Если у вас есть какие-либо вопросы, вы можете задать их на нашем форуме.